
The Grand clash of talented artists has finally come to an
end as
Mitoy from
Team Lea bested all contestants from
the blind auditions to the grand finale. With 57.65 percent of public votes,
Mitoy earned the highest score of them all. He has stayed strong throughout the
Top 24 and showed his skills and promise for the music industry as he achieved
the wanted title of
The First Ever ‘The
Voice of the Philippines’ winner!
The finale started out with a blast performance by Jed Madela and Arnel Pineda along with the Top
24 artists singing “We Will Rock You”.
Hosts Toni Gonzaga, Alex Gonzaga and
Robi Domingo then pumped up the
audience and viewers as they introduced each finalist individually.
Competition started with the duets between coaches and
artists as coach Sarah Geronimo and
artist Klarisse de Guzman started
with a beautiful ballad with “Your Song”.
Up next was Myk Perez along with
coach Bamboo with Myk on the guitar
and Bamboo dancing with a ballerina to the song “Morning Rose”. Putting life to the stage, coach Apl de Ap and artist Janice Javier performed “Himig na Pag-ibig” and “The Time” along with Lolita Carbon, making the crowd and
judges get up and dance along. Finishing up the duets was coach Lea Salonga with artist Mitoy in an emotional and the bomb
performance of “Total Eclipse of the
Heart” which was accompanied by Vice
Ganda.

To keep the energy and excitement up, the
Top 4 presented
The Final Showdown performances as their last chance to blow away
the audience and viewers and win their hearts and votes. First up to bat was
Klarisse representing
Team Sarah with the song “
I’m Every Woman” followed by
Team Bamboo’s
Myk Perez singing “
Everything”.
Janice Javier then took up the stage
representing
Team Apl with her
rendition of “
We Found Love”. Ending
the showdown was
Team Lea’s artist
Mitoy performing “
Leaving on a Jetplane”.
Following the wonderful performances of the amazing Top 4
was Shane Filan who was a member of
former boyband, Westlife. The Top 4
artists had the honor to sing along with him. Many fans felt melancholic as
they reminisced on the former boyband and their greatness in the music industry
where they left a legacy.
The long awaited performance of “The Voice of the Philippines” coaches happened with an inspiring
performance by Apl de Ap, Lea Salonga,
Bamboo, and Sarah Geronimo with
their beautiful rendition of Michael
Jackson’s “Man in the Mirror.”
As the announcement to who the first ever ‘Voice’ of the
Philippines drew nearer, the revealing of the Top 2 finalists were announced
first. Through much voting and hardcore battles, the Top2 were revealed as Mitoy from Team Lea and Klarisse de
Guzman from Team Sarah. The
announcement recharged the voting poll back to zero for both artists as voting
opened back up for number one.
Taking the stage one more time to sing for the title of ‘The
Voice’ was Klarisse with the song “Magsimula”
and Mitoy with his performance of “Help
Me If You Can”. Both wowed the audience as they sang their hearts away for
their dreams and the viewer’s votes.

The results of the winner were then finally announced after
all the blood, sweat, and tear poured into the show, performances, and votes
were shed during the Grand Finale. With many screams and shouts for the artist,
Mitoy Yonting was officially crowned
as the first ever Voice of the Philippines. Congratulations to the guidance and
expertise of Lea Salonga and others, Team Lea has been the benchmark and
winner of the first season with the artistic talent of Mitoy.
Mitoy has not only won the grand title of the first ever
‘Voice’ of the Philippines but also
a new car, an Asian tour package for two, P2million, and a four-year recording contract with MCA Universal.
